Belonging and Connection Matter

One of the most important parts of senior well-being is feeling like you belong. When you live in a place where people know your name and care about how you’re doing, it lifts your spirits. Simple things like chatting with a neighbor or joining a group for coffee can make your day brighter.

Being part of a community helps fight off loneliness, which is a common problem for older adults. When seniors have people around them, they feel less alone and more connected. That feeling of belonging supports emotional health and brings joy to everyday life.

Staying Active in the Right Setting

Movement is good for the body and the mind. Seniors who live in active communities often walk more, try new classes, or spend time outside. All of this helps keep muscles strong and minds clear. Whether it’s a morning stretch or a garden walk, activity helps seniors feel better and sleep better.

In the right neighborhood, it’s easy to stay active without even thinking about it. Wide walkways, green spaces, and fun programs make it simple to keep moving. These small daily steps lead to big health benefits over time.

Good Food and Good Company

Eating well is easier when you’re surrounded by others who care. In a close-knit community, meals often become something to look forward to. Seniors can sit with friends, enjoy healthy dishes, and relax during mealtimes.

Sharing a meal is more than just eating-it’s about being together. Talking, laughing, and feeling included during meals helps support emotional health too. It turns every bite into a chance to connect.

A Place That Feels Like Home

Where you live should feel warm, safe, and welcoming. A well-designed senior community offers comfort and peace of mind. Private living spaces give seniors independence, while shared areas bring people together. Everything from cozy chairs to quiet gardens helps create a place where seniors feel calm and cared for.
